Direct Reprogramming of Human Neurons Identifies MARCKSL1 as a Pathogenic Mediator of Valproic Acid-Induced Teratogenicity

Human pluripotent stem cells can be rapidly converted into functional neurons by ectopic expression of proneural transcription factors.
